Application

4-Methoxyphenylmagnesium bromide is a general Grignard reagent that can be used:
  • In the denickelation of porphyrins and to replace the metal center with magnesium.
  • To synthesize a tubulin polymerization inhibitor, 2-Amino-3,4,5-trimethoxybenzophenone.
  • In the total synthesis of (−)-centrolobine.
